【java实训课】工程项目文件(IDEA+MYSQL)
文章目錄
- 軟件方向?qū)嵺`
- Java Web 開發(fā)
- 環(huán)境:
- 項目文件
- 結(jié)果展示
- 總結(jié):
- 參考資料
軟件方向?qū)嵺`
Java Web 開發(fā)
| 2021.12.27 | 數(shù)據(jù)庫相關(guān)操作 | 數(shù)據(jù)庫相關(guān)指令熟悉 |
| 2021.12.28 | web項目創(chuàng)建,首頁的顯示 | web+tomcat idea的使用,使用servelet |
| 2022.01.04 | 首頁分頁功能,顯示詳情頁面 , 增加評論功能 | 熟悉網(wǎng)頁標(biāo)簽和請求封裝 |
servelet 理論知識
環(huán)境:
- 編譯器:IDEA2021.3 專業(yè)版(教育郵箱申請)
- 數(shù)據(jù)庫:Mysql + Navicat 15
項目文件
筆記文件傳輸門:
實訓(xùn)課筆記記錄
- 實踐步驟:
- 連接數(shù)據(jù)庫–建表等等
- 封裝DAO
- 創(chuàng)建web項目使用tomcat連接本地8080端口
- 導(dǎo)入樣式文件,顯示首頁,同時顯示數(shù)據(jù)庫news 信息在首頁;
結(jié)果展示
-
首頁分頁,總共7條數(shù)據(jù),分成兩頁;
-
第二頁:
-
詳情頁面:
-
評論頁面
解決中文亂碼:
方法1:
String str = new String(req.getParameter(“cauthor”).getBytes(“ISO-8859-1”),“utf-8”);
comment.setCauthor(str);
- 設(shè)置首頁顯示
文件資源代碼傳輸門:
項目文件代碼和資料
總結(jié):
成功不會自動送上門來,幸福也不會自動降臨到一個人身上。這個世界上所有美好的東西都需要主動爭取,加油!!!
- 為期4天的java實踐課,跟著老師從頭開始一步一步搭建網(wǎng)頁,大部分顯示的東西都是課程資料,但是還是比較考驗思維和遇到問題的解決能力。這個實踐基本上都能有效的利用好課堂的時間完成大部分功能;
實踐的難點:
基本上是工具的使用;由于沒有前端開發(fā)的基礎(chǔ),不過對于javascript有些基本的了解,上手比較快;
其次整個實踐老師教學(xué)過程使用的是eclipse ,然而我還是比較習(xí)慣使用IDEA進行編程;這兩個工具操作上基本是一致,剛開始會遇到一點點問題,不過基本都是能夠找到解決方法的;
其次是數(shù)據(jù)庫的安裝,數(shù)據(jù)庫之前做java實驗課仿真QQ程序的時候已經(jīng)安裝好了數(shù)據(jù)庫,所有在這個方面沒有遇到問題,不過之前裝數(shù)據(jù)庫也是遇到了不少問題:
這里又知道了一個更塊安裝數(shù)據(jù)庫的方法;
直接使用解壓包進行安裝,只需要修改配置文件的信息,就可以安裝好數(shù)據(jù)庫,之后安裝mysql服務(wù)就能夠使用數(shù)據(jù)庫;
其次是使用DAO(數(shù)據(jù)訪問對象模式)訪問數(shù)據(jù)庫,能夠更好的管理連接信息;
再者是對于 tomacat 搭建 servelet 的熟悉使用;
參考資料
總結(jié)
以上是生活随笔為你收集整理的【java实训课】工程项目文件(IDEA+MYSQL)的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 【java实训课】web网页相关知识点总
- 下一篇: 【Git/Github】第一次提交和再次